Best known in his early career as SoFloAntonio, Antonio Lievano was once at the center of the viral video boom. His Facebook page drew in billions of views, dominating timelines across the world. But rather than remain a personality forever, Antonio Lievano chose a different path. He stepped away from the spotlight and into the world of digital systems, ecommerce, poker, and most recently, artificial intelligence.

The Shift from Spotlight to Substance

What separates Antonio Lievano from many of his peers is how little he chases attention today. After facing both massive praise and harsh criticism in his early career, he realized that impact matters more than public opinion. His name trended on social platforms. He was mentioned in songs by Post Malone. He even faced viral backlash from major YouTubers.

But through it all, Antonio Lievano kept building.

He took the lessons from those experiences and applied them in quiet, strategic ways. He studied poker and became a serious competitor. According to WSOP.com, he has earned over $429,000 in tournament winnings. He developed private mentorship frameworks. He began designing white-label systems for other creators and founders.

And he did it all without needing to be front and center.
